The Rise of Digital Nomadism
There are a number of causes for the development of digital nomadism. The growth of the internet and remote employment opportunities comes first. Many tasks may now be completed from anywhere with a reliable internet connection thanks to advancements in technology.
Numerous people have been freed from the constraints of a physical office thanks to this change, which allows them to select their work location, whether it’s a busy cafe in Bali, a peaceful beach in Mexico, or a comfortable cottage in the Swiss Alps. Due to their increased freedom, an increasing number of people are choosing to lead a nomadic existence as digital nomads.

Choosing Your Destinations
The opportunity to experience various cultures and environments while working is one of the lifestyle’s most intriguing facets. Think about things like the cost of living, visa requirements, safety, and internet access before deciding where to go. Chiang Mai, Bali, Lisbon, Medellin, Tbilisi, and Cape Town are a few of the well-liked locations for digital nomads, but the options are practically limitless. Planning Your Finances
A significant component of the digital nomad lifestyle is financial planning. A financial safety net is necessary to guarantee your peace of mind while traveling, even though it may sound alluring to quit your work and fly off to far-flung locales. Before you start your journey, plan your finances carefully, set up an emergency fund, and make sure you have a reliable source of income.
Be prepared for unforeseen costs by taking into account the cost of living in the destinations you want to visit. Learn about the tax laws that apply to digital nomads as well, as your income may come from a variety of places and sources.
